The Role of Empathy In Human Development & Psychoanalysis - Heinz Kohut, M.D.
Dr. Kohut’s insights into the nature of empathy challenge us to go beyond our assumptions and vague notions. Dr. Kohut discusses the crucial factor that distinguishes Self Psychology from traditional psychoanalysis.

Reconstructions of the Validity of the Negative Therapeutic Reaction - Heinz Kohut, M.D.
Dr. Kohut discusses how the ‘negative therapeutic reaction theory’ precludes deeper insight and can get in the way of empathizing with our clients. At worst, over-reliance on theory may lead to objectification, in which the traumatic, non-empathic environment of childhood is recreated.

Reflections of Empathy - Heinz Kohut, M.D.
Is empathy a sufficient condition for healing in therapy? No. And yes. Dr. Kohut explains how a therapist’s empathic reconstruction of the client’s past, through interpretation, is what heals the client. His insights into disintegration anxiety and the developmental line of empathy are relevant for therapists of all traditions.
